Hi

 

On Star the smoking area at H20 was eliminated; when I spoke to the food/beverage director he said some people had been eating back there, and complained that they could smell smoke from the other side of H20 so there is no more smoking in H20 on the Star :classic_blink:.  I cruised 11/5-11/30/2018, just off.

13 hours ago, Greenpea2 said:

A friend recently back from the Bliss said there is still a smoking area on the Haven sun deck. Might be the smaller ships with less Haven space are giving it the axe. But so far it’s still ok on the Bliss. Apparently it is in an area and protected with plexiglass and does not bother non smokers.

Correct. On Bliss the sundeck wraps around deck 19 (unlike other ships of this class). There are two well-separated forward areas with lounge chairs -- one is smoking and one is non-smoking.
